A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Treiber Info auslesen

Ein Thema von Saiiim · begonnen am 29. Jul 2004 · letzter Beitrag vom 29. Jul 2004
Antwort Antwort
Seite 1 von 2  1 2      
Saiiim

Registriert seit: 29. Jul 2004
11 Beiträge
 
#1

Treiber Info auslesen

  Alt 29. Jul 2004, 09:49
Morgääähn Leutz!

Hätte da mal ne frage:
Hat jemand eine Idee wie ich Treiberinformationen (Version, Hersteller, Datum, Signatur) von
div. Komponenten (im konkreten Fall Soundkarte) auslesen kann???

danke schon mal
geht nit - gibts nit!
  Mit Zitat antworten Zitat
Robert Marquardt
(Gast)

n/a Beiträge
 
#2

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 10:14
Ein Treiber ist eigentlich eine Kernel DLL. Probier doch mal die Versionsressource zu lesen wie bei einer DLL.
Ich habe es gerade mit PEViewer ausprobiert. Ein .SYS wird als DLL akzeptiert.
  Mit Zitat antworten Zitat
Saiiim

Registriert seit: 29. Jul 2004
11 Beiträge
 
#3

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 10:52
vielen dank erstmal,

aber das problem ist, dass i da ja die treiberdatei kennen muss!
ich möchte ein programm schreiben, welches verschiedenste informationen über
hardware ausliest!
erste versuche mache ich bei der soundkarte, wobei ich schon so sachen wie
name, hersteller, id
über Windows API auslesen kann!
und jetzt dachte ich da gäbe es auch eine einfache lösung, an
diese treiberinfos ranzukommen!
geht nit - gibts nit!
  Mit Zitat antworten Zitat
Benutzerbild von Steve
Steve

Registriert seit: 2. Mär 2004
Ort: Würzburg
730 Beiträge
 
Delphi 2006 Personal
 
#4

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 10:55
Zitat von Saiiim:
Treiberinformationen (Version, Hersteller, Datum, Signatur) von
div. Komponenten (im konkreten Fall Soundkarte) ???
Für Soundkarten-Infos schau Dir mal MSDN-Library durchsuchenMixer, MSDN-Library durchsuchenMixerCaps, MSDN-Library durchsuchenMixerGetLineInfo und MSDN-Library durchsuchenMixerLine an..

Gruß
Stephan
Stephan B.
Wer andern eine Grube gräbt ist Bauarbeiter!
Wer im Glashaus sitzt, sollte sich lieber im Dunkeln ausziehen!
Außerdem dieser Satz kein Verb...
  Mit Zitat antworten Zitat
Saiiim

Registriert seit: 29. Jul 2004
11 Beiträge
 
#5

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 11:00
danke, werde mich gleich mal schlau machen

mfg
geht nit - gibts nit!
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#6

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 11:04
Das mit den Treiberinfos auf die Hardware zu schließen ist so eine Sache. Für meine Diamnd Viper V770 nutze ich einen NVidia Treiber. Bei so Info Tools habe ich daher noch nie Diamond Viper gelesen.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Benutzerbild von mirage228
mirage228

Registriert seit: 23. Mär 2003
Ort: Münster
3.750 Beiträge
 
Delphi 2010 Professional
 
#7

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 11:06
Zitat von Luckie:
Das mit den Treiberinfos auf die Hardware zu schließen ist so eine Sache. Für meine Diamnd Viper V770 nutze ich einen NVidia Treiber. Bei so Info Tools habe ich daher noch nie Diamond Viper gelesen.
Bei mir ists ähnlich, habe eine Creative Grafikkarte, aber den Offiziellen Detonator installiert, der Gerätemanager zeigt daher auch nur "GeForce 4 Ti 4400" an - ja gut, bei meiner Soundkarte ist es richtig eingetragen

mfG
mirage228
David F.

May the source be with you, stranger.
PHP Inspection Unit (Delphi-Unit zum Analysieren von PHP Code)
  Mit Zitat antworten Zitat
shmia

Registriert seit: 2. Mär 2004
5.508 Beiträge
 
Delphi 5 Professional
 
#8

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 11:10
In der JCL ist ein Demo (NTSrvExample.DPR) enthalten, dass alle Services (=Dienste + Gerätetreiber) auflistet und unter anderem
auch den Dateinamen des Treibers preisgibt.
Damit lässt sich dann die Versioninfo auslesen.
Andreas
  Mit Zitat antworten Zitat
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#9

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 11:10
soundkarte ist was anderes. Da hab eich den Treiber der auf der MB CD dabei war installiert, weil ich auch Sound OnBoard habe. Ich wollte nur allgemnein auf das Problem hinweisen. Aber wie ich es bei den Toolös immer sehe, gibt es dafür wohl keine wirkliche Windows Lösung, weil man unter Windows nur das auslesen kann, was auch Windows meint und Windows meint ja auch ich hätte eine NVidia Karte drinne. Was anderes wäre es, wenn die Karte selbst dem BIOS sagt, was es für eine ist, dann könnte man versuchen das BIOS zu befragen.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at
Saiiim

Registriert seit: 29. Jul 2004
11 Beiträge
 
#10

Re: Treiber Info auslesen

  Alt 29. Jul 2004, 12:37
das ist gar nicht das problem,
denn den richtigen namen der hardware (soundkarte) hab ich bereits
durch die Windows API herausgefunden!
ich wollte nur dazu die treiberinfos, somit ist es egal was für ein treiber
installiert ist!

@ shmia: das wäre perfekt, ich kann die demo datei nicht finden, könntest du mir bitte sagn
wo die zum downloadn steht? danke

mfg saiiim
geht nit - gibts nit!
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:58 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z